#460cce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#460cce is composed of 27.5% red, 4.7% green and 80.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 66% cyan, 94.2% magenta, 0% yellow and 19.2% black. It has a hue angle of 257.9 degrees, a saturation of 89% and a lightness of 42.7%. #460cce color hex could be obtained by blending #8c18ff with #00009d. Closest websafe color is: #3300cc.

#460cce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#460cce has RGB values of R:70, G:12, B:206 and CMYK values of C:0.66, M:0.94, Y:0, K:0.19. Its decimal value is 4590798.
